test/hotspot/jtreg/vmTestbase/nsk/jvmti/SetFieldAccessWatch/setfldw005/setfldw005.cpp
changeset 51767 497950fd69a7
parent 51729 1ebe04845112
child 52642 9cfc8b0c45fd
equal deleted inserted replaced
51766:3ca7d5385653 51767:497950fd69a7
   152         return;
   152         return;
   153     }
   153     }
   154 
   154 
   155     for (i = 0; i < sizeof(fields) / sizeof(field); i++) {
   155     for (i = 0; i < sizeof(fields) / sizeof(field); i++) {
   156         if (fields[i].stat == JNI_TRUE) {
   156         if (fields[i].stat == JNI_TRUE) {
   157             fields[i].fid = env-> GetStaticFieldID(
   157             fields[i].fid = env->GetStaticFieldID(cls, fields[i].name, fields[i].sig);
   158                 cls, fields[i].name, fields[i].sig);
       
   159         } else {
   158         } else {
   160             fields[i].fid = env->GetFieldID(
   159             fields[i].fid = env->GetFieldID(cls, fields[i].name, fields[i].sig);
   161                 cls, fields[i].name, fields[i].sig);
       
   162         }
   160         }
   163         if (fields[i].fid == NULL) {
   161         if (fields[i].fid == NULL) {
   164             printf("Unable to set access watch on %s fld%" PRIuPTR ", fieldID=0",
   162             printf("Unable to set access watch on %s fld%" PRIuPTR ", fieldID=0",
   165                    fields[i].descr, i);
   163                    fields[i].descr, i);
   166         } else {
   164         } else {